How Ensuring Public Safety in Deltona: A Glimpse into the Deltona Police Department Actually Works

At its core, Ensuring Public Safety in Deltona: A Glimpse into the Deltona Police Department is about coordination, visibility, and communication between officers and the people they serve. The Deltona Police Department operates through a combination of patrol units, specialized teams, and partnerships with other agencies. Officers respond to emergency calls, conduct proactive patrols, and engage with neighborhoods through outreach events and community policing forums.

Dispatch serves as the central hub, routing 911 calls to the nearest available units and coordinating with fire, emergency medical services, and neighboring jurisdictions. When a call comes in—whether it’s a medical emergency, a traffic collision, or a report of suspicious activity—dispatchers gather key details and prioritize response based on urgency and available resources. Officers then arrive on scene, assess the situation, and take steps to de-escalate conflicts while documenting the incident for follow-up review.

Technology also plays a major role in modern policing. Mobile data terminals in patrol cars allow officers to check records in real time, verify license plates, and access safety alerts. Surveillance cameras, automated license plate readers, and digital evidence management systems help investigators solve cases more efficiently. Residents may notice officers using body cameras during interactions, which supports both accountability and transparency. Things People Often Misunderstand

A common myth is that visible policing always means aggressive policing. In reality, many departments prioritize de-escalation, verbal communication, and problem-solving over physical intervention. Officers are trained to use a range of tactics depending on the situation, and most daily interactions between police and residents are peaceful and routine.

Another misunderstanding is that crime data tells the whole story. Statistics can reflect reporting patterns, investigative timelines, and classification choices as much as actual crime trends. For example, an increase in reported thefts might partly reflect greater public awareness and willingness to file reports rather than a sudden spike in criminal activity. Looking at data over time and in context helps avoid knee-jerk conclusions.
